Proofing skills sets your dog up for success

Do you ever find yourself saying “but they do it so well at home!” when it comes to a specific skill in agility?

If so, you’re not alone! Many handlers say that their dog can perform a skill well in training but when they go somewhere new, or there are more distractions around, the skill suddenly becomes unreliable: The dog might break a startline, pop out of the weaves, refuse a jump or leap off the side of the contact. This doesn’t mean the dog “forgot” the skill, it just means the skill hasn’t been proofed under different situations yet.

Dogs don’t automatically generalise behaviours the way humans expect. They need practice performing the same skill in many different environments and with different distractions. Our free skill proofing checklist and training log will help you achieve just that!

Skill proofing is the process of gradually teaching your dog that a behaviour still applies even when something around them changes.
